#437166 Hex Color Code

#437166

The Hexadecimal Color #437166 is a contrast shade of Sea Green. #437166 RGB value is rgb(67, 113, 102). RGB Color Model of #437166 consists of 26% red, 44% green and 40% blue. HSL color Mode of #437166 has 166°(degrees) Hue, 26% Saturation and 35% Lightness. #437166 color has an wavelength of 515.48148n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#437166 is #669999.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#437166 is #476. The Closest Color to #437166 is #2E8B57. Official Name of #437166 Hex Code is Como.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#437166 is 41 Cyan 0 Magenta 10 Yellow 56 Black and #437166 CMY is 41, 0, 10.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#437166 is hsl(166,26,35,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(166, 41, 44).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#437166 is 10.62, 13.96, 14.7.
Hex8 Value of #437166 is #437166FF. Decimal Value of #437166 is 4419942 and Octal Value of #437166 is 20670546. Binary Value of #437166 is 1000011, 1110001, 1100110 and Android of #437166 is 4282610022 / 0xff437166.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#437166 is 0.27, 0.355, 0.355 and YIQ Color Space of #437166 is 97.992, -23.8771, -13.1522.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#437166 is 11.39, 16.31, 14.68.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#437166 is 44.18, -18.55, 1.15.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#437166 is 44.18, -21.25, 4.22.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#437166 is 44.18, 18.59, 176.45. Hunter Lab variable of #437166 is 37.36, -14.65, 2.83.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#437166

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
